The technician of Germany, Hansi Flick, will have an important absence in the friendlies against Peru and Belgium. Jamal Musiala, midfielder for Bayern Munchensuffered a thigh injury last Sunday and was cut from the final list.
The 20-year-old ruptured a tendon in his left thigh against Bayer Leverkusen for German Championship. Musiala was replaced by coach Julian Nagelsmann still at halftime and had his injury detected on Monday.

“We all expected Jamal to be fit because he has unique qualities. It’s a shame he can’t be here. We wish him an excellent and speedy recovery and that he can play after the break for national team games ”, lamented Flick.
Formed in the Chelsea academy, Musiala could choose to defend England, as he has dual nationality. However, the athlete decided to defend the country he was born after moving to Bayern. For the German club, the midfielder gained space last season and has been part of the starting lineup.
Germany have yet to announce who will replace Musiala in the friendlies. The team will face Peru on Saturday (25) and Belgium next Tuesday (28). The matches served as a preparation for Euro 2024, in which the country will be responsible for hosting the tournament.
